leansdr consists of:
* A simple data-flow framework for signal processing
* A library of software-defined radio functions
* Applications built on top of the above.

Currently the main application is leandvb.

leandvb is a lightweight implementation of portions of the DVB-S standard.
It is developed primarily for receiving Digital Amateur TV,i including
HamTV from the International Space Station.

- Update to version 1.2.0.27:
  * Customizable FFT size and zoom for spectrum display.
  * Allow non-blocking stdin for leandvbtx real-time mode.
  * leanmlmrx: Handle last channel in a range more reliably.
  * Add leansdrserv: Network access to leansdr command  pipelines
  * Add --version
  * Add leaniio{rx,tx}: PlutoSDR support via libiio.
  * Add leanmlmrx: Multi-channel FM demodulator
  * leandvb: Document --s16
  * Add non-standard rate 4/5 puncturing pattern for DVB-S 32APSK
  * Add --rrc-rej, --s16 output format
  * Add spectrum output and JSON syntax for third-party GUIs
  * Support non-standard constellations with DVB-S --viterbi.
